Research Department) Number: 396 Abstract: In this paper, we extend the growth model to include firm-specific technology capital and use it to assess the gains from opening to foreign direct investment. A firm’s technology capital is its unique know-how from investing in research and development, brands, and organization capital. Technology capital is distinguished from other forms of capital in that a firm can use it simultaneously in multiple domestic and foreign locations. A country can exploit foreign technology capital by permitting direct investment by foreign multinationals. In both steady-state and transitional analyses, the extended growth model predicts large gains to being open.

Research Department) Number: 308 Abstract: We analyze the setting of monetary and nonmonetary policies in monetary unions. We show that in these unions a time inconsistency problem in monetary policy leads to a novel type of free-rider problem in the setting of nonmonetary policies, such as labor market policy, fiscal policy, and bank regulation. The free-rider problem leads the union’s members to pursue lax nonmonetary policies that induce the monetary authority to generate high inflation. The free-rider problem can be mitigated by imposing constraints on the nonmonetary policies, like unionwide rules on labor market policy, debt constraints on members’ fiscal policy, and unionwide regulation of banks. When there is no time inconsistency problem, there is no free-rider problem, and constraints on nonmonetary policies are unnecessary and possibly harmful.

Research Department) Number: 402 Abstract: Arrow (1962) argued that since a monopoly restricts output relative to a competitive industry, it would be less willing to pay a fixed cost to adopt a new technology. Arrow’s idea has been challenged and critiques have shown that under different assumptions, increases in competition lead to less innovation. We develop a new theory of why a monopolistic industry innovates less than a competitive industry. The key is that firms often face major problems in integrating new technologies. In some cases, upon adoption of technology, firms must temporarily reduce output. We call such problems switchover disruptions. If firms face switchover disruptions, then a cost of adoption is the forgone rents on the sales of lost or delayed production, and these opportunity costs are larger the higher the price on those lost units. In particular, with greater monopoly power, the greater the forgone rents. This idea has significant consequences since if we add switchover disruptions to standard models, then the critiques of Arrow lose their force: competition again leads to greater adoption. In addition, we show that our model helps explain the accumulating evidence that competition leads to greater adoption (whereas the standard models cannot).

Research Department) Number: 418 Abstract: Three of the arguments made by Temin (2008) in his review of Great Depressions of the Twentieth Century are demonstrably wrong: that the treatment of the data in the volume is cursory; that the definition of great depressions is too general and, in particular, groups slow growth experiences in Latin America in the 1980s with far more severe great depressions in Europe in the 1930s; and that the book is an advertisement for the real business cycle methodology. Without these three arguments — which are the results of obvious conceptual and arithmetical errors, including copying the wrong column of data from a source — his review says little more than that he does not think it appropriate to apply our dynamic general equilibrium methodology to the study of great depressions, and he does not like the conclusion that we draw: that a successful model of a great depression needs to be able to account for the effects of government policy on productivity.

Research Department) Number: 315 Abstract: There is much debate about the usefulness of the neoclassical growth model for assessing the macroeconomic impact of fiscal shocks. We test the theory using data from World War II, which is by far the largest fiscal shock in the history of the United States. We take observed changes in fiscal policy during the war as inputs into a parameterized, dynamic general equilibrium model and compare the values of all variables in the model to the actual values of these variables in the data. Our main finding is that the theory quantitatively accounts for macroeconomic activity during this big fiscal shock.
